> o	Isn't the addition of "sequentially consistent ordered stores"
> 	to the "synchronizes with" relation redundant given that ordered
> 	stores have both acquire and release semantics and that "happens
> 	before" is transitive?
Sequentially consistent stores only have release semantics, but they
have the additional constraint that all sequentially consistent atomic
operations appear in a single total order, and that loads must see the
last preceding store in that order.  They don't have acquire semantics.
In the current formulation, acquire semantics wouldn't make sense since
whether or not an acquire operation introduces a synchronizes with
relationship depends on the value read, and there is no such thing here.
